From ce96cfb2924ad500677f58ed7d0e04fcfa8b488e Mon Sep 17 00:00:00 2001 From: Corinna Vinschen Date: Thu, 10 Jul 2008 18:05:03 +0000 Subject: [PATCH] * cyglsa.c: Revamp debugging output. (LsaApInitializePackage): Open debugging output file here. (LsaApLogonUserEx): Replace LsaApLogonUser. Add debugging output. Create machine name for accounting.
